summaryrefslogtreecommitdiff
path: root/cmake
diff options
context:
space:
mode:
authorrikky <rikky@ffa7fe5e-494d-0410-b361-a75ebd5db220>2010-10-03 22:32:20 +0000
committerrikky <rikky@ffa7fe5e-494d-0410-b361-a75ebd5db220>2010-10-03 22:32:20 +0000
commit95cb15d62fbddb2a17358823869d9af968e57f8e (patch)
tree0ac0c1cea7d7db2b72ae1f51cd4d4d45e08837c0 /cmake
parent76d765783b4fa018fff7dba93639a76ca9be1a3e (diff)
downloadnavit-95cb15d62fbddb2a17358823869d9af968e57f8e.tar.gz
Fix:core/cmake:Install modules to the same path as the autotools toolchain does
git-svn-id: http://svn.code.sf.net/p/navit/code/trunk/navit@3592 ffa7fe5e-494d-0410-b361-a75ebd5db220
Diffstat (limited to 'cmake')
-rw-r--r--cmake/navit_macros.cmake7
1 files changed, 1 insertions, 6 deletions
diff --git a/cmake/navit_macros.cmake b/cmake/navit_macros.cmake
index cc8b714a8..8188aad82 100644
--- a/cmake/navit_macros.cmake
+++ b/cmake/navit_macros.cmake
@@ -18,7 +18,6 @@ macro(add_plugin PLUGIN_PATH)
endmacro()
macro(module_add_library MODULE_NAME )
-# add_definitions( -DMODULE=${MODULE_NAME} -fPIC)
add_library(${MODULE_NAME} ${MODULE_BUILD_TYPE} ${ARGN})
SET_TARGET_PROPERTIES(${MODULE_NAME} PROPERTIES COMPILE_DEFINITIONS "MODULE=${MODULE_NAME}")
@@ -26,10 +25,9 @@ macro(module_add_library MODULE_NAME )
SET_TARGET_PROPERTIES( ${LIB_NAME} PROPERTIES COMPILE_FLAGS ${NAVIT_COMPILE_FLAGS})
TARGET_LINK_LIBRARIES(${MODULE_NAME} navit_core)
install(TARGETS ${MODULE_NAME}
- DESTINATION ${LIB_DIR}/navit
+ DESTINATION ${LIB_DIR}/navit/${${MODULE_NAME}_TYPE}
PERMISSIONS OWNER_READ OWNER_WRITE OWNER_EXECUTE GROUP_READ GROUP_EXECUTE WORLD_READ WORLD_EXECUTE)
endif()
-# TARGET_LINK_LIBRARIES(${MODULE_NAME} ${NAVIT_SUPPORT_LIBS})
endmacro(module_add_library)
macro(supportlib_add_library LIB_NAME )
@@ -38,7 +36,4 @@ macro(supportlib_add_library LIB_NAME )
SET_TARGET_PROPERTIES( ${LIB_NAME} PROPERTIES COMPILE_FLAGS ${NAVIT_COMPILE_FLAGS})
TARGET_LINK_LIBRARIES(${MODULE_NAME} navit_core)
endif()
-# SET_TARGET_PROPERTIES(${LIB_NAME} PROPERTIES COMPILE_DEFINITIONS "MODULE=${LIB_NAME}")
-
-# TARGET_LINK_LIBRARIES(${LIB_NAME} ${NAVIT_SUPPORT_LIBS})
endmacro(supportlib_add_library)